Objective

This study aimed to investigate which of the decompression alone (DA), decompression with fusion (DF), and decompression with dynamic stabilization (DS) produced the most favorable outcome for patients with low-grade degenerative lumbar spondylolisthesis (LDLS).

Material and method

Pubmed, Embase, Cochrane, and Web of Science were searched for all studies published before October 1, 2023. A review and data analysis of all randomized controlled trials (RCTs) of three interventions was performed by Stata (version 17.0) and Review Manager (version 5.4).

Result

21 RCT studies with 3192 patients were included in the network meta-analysis. DA was superior to DF (MD = -92.05, P < 0.05; MD = -295.57, P < 0.05; MD = -2.19, P < 0.05; RR = 0.54, P < 0.05, respectively) and DS (MD = -35.69, P < 0.05; MD = -100.7, P < 0.05; MD = -295.57, P < 0.05; MD = -2.19, P < 0.05; RR = 0.54, P < 0.05, respectively) in reducing operative time, intraoperative blood loss, length of hospital stay, and postoperative adverse events. DS was superior to DF in reducing operative time, intraoperative blood loss, and length of hospital stay (MD = -56.35, P < 0.05; MD = -194.84, P < 0.05; MD = -1.12, P < 0.05, respectively). DF was superior to DA in reducing reoperations (RR = 0.55, p < 0.05). DF was superior to DA (MD = -1.44, p < 0.05) and DS (MD = -0.41, p < 0.05) in controlling the progression of olisthesis.

Conclusion

DA was the most favorable treatment for LDLS, reducing operative time, bleeding, hospital stay, and postoperative complications. DF outperformed DA in reducing reoperation rates. Although DS showed benefits in operative time and bleeding compared to DF, it did not offer a significant advantage over DA.
